Heather Mills is a model and a social activist. She was married to Paul McCartney for six years before getting divorced in 2008.

Nanny Lawsuit
Mill's former nanny Sara Trumble filed suit against Mills in late December 2008 for alleged sex discrimination. Trumble claims that she was given duties other than what she was hired for, which was to be a nanny for Mill's daughter, Beatrice. She claims that she was asked to give Mills naked spray tans, blow dry her hair as well as work late at night. Mills and Trumble have 28 days to settle the dispute. If they can't reach an agreement, the case will be settled in court.Mail Online: Mills's nanny sues for sex discrimination... (December 29, 2008)
Career and Life Highlights
Mills has certainly lived a star-crossed life to say the least. She survived a sexual assault when she was just 8 years old, comes from a broken household, was once homeless and was placed on probation for stealing jewelry, all before her 18th birthday. In 1986, she set up her own modeling agency and became infamous in Europe for a series of suggestive photographs taken in Germany in which she posed nude and simulated sexual acts. In 1992, Mills became active in helping Croatians during the war in the former Yugoslavia, provided shelter and supplies, paying for her escapades by modeling. In 1993, she was involved in a serious accident when struck by a police car, resulting in the amputation of her left leg below the knee. In addition to her famed marriage to McCartney, she was also married for two years to Alfie Karmal. The relationship with McCartney began in April of 1999. They were married in 2002 and had a daughter named Beatrice McCartney. The couple divorced in 2008.
